Plate engraved, printed and colored by Havell in London.
Boston, Suffolk, Massachusetts, New England, United States, North America
Presumably painted by Audubon in the 1820s. The adult male at right was cut out from an earlier painting and added to this one.

From the first edition double-elephant folio of John James Audubon, The Birds of America (London: J. J. Audubon, 1827-39).
